Abstract
The continuous growth of historical literature on the situation and everyday difficulties of religious minorities shows that the study of local communities can always add further details and enrich knowledge on the coexistence of denominations and conflicts between them.2 In this study I analyse a previously unexamined slice in the social history of Csongrád, the path and possibilities of the local Calvinist minority for social integration from the early 19th century up to the construction of the Csongrád Calvinist church (1937).
